@@ -0,0 +1,222 @@
package hub
import (
"beszel/internal/entities/system"
"fmt"
"log"
"os"
"path/filepath"
"strconv"
"github.com/labstack/echo/v5"
"github.com/pocketbase/dbx"
"github.com/pocketbase/pocketbase/apis"
"github.com/pocketbase/pocketbase/models"
"github.com/spf13/cast"
"gopkg.in/yaml.v3"
)
type Config struct {
Systems []SystemConfig `yaml:"systems"`
}
type SystemConfig struct {
Name string `yaml:"name"`
Host string `yaml:"host"`
Port uint16 `yaml:"port"`
Users []string `yaml:"users"`
}
// Syncs systems with the config.yml file
func (h *Hub) syncSystemsWithConfig() error {
configPath := filepath.Join(h.app.DataDir(), "config.yml")
configData, err := os.ReadFile(configPath)
if err != nil {
return nil
}
var config Config
err = yaml.Unmarshal(configData, &config)
if err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("failed to parse config.yml: %v", err)
}
if len(config.Systems) == 0 {
log.Println("No systems defined in config.yml.")
return nil
}
var firstUser *models.Record
// Create a map of email to user ID
userEmailToID := make(map[string]string)
users, err := h.app.Dao().FindRecordsByExpr("users", dbx.NewExp("id != ''"))
if err != nil {
return err
}
if len(users) > 0 {
firstUser = users[0]
for _, user := range users {
userEmailToID[user.GetString("email")] = user.Id
}
}
// add default settings for systems if not defined in config
for i := range config.Systems {
system := &config.Systems[i]
if system.Port == 0 {
system.Port = 45876
}
if len(users) > 0 && len(system.Users) == 0 {
// default to first user if none are defined
system.Users = []string{firstUser.Id}
} else {
// Convert email addresses to user IDs
userIDs := make([]string, 0, len(system.Users))
for _, email := range system.Users {
if id, ok := userEmailToID[email]; ok {
userIDs = append(userIDs, id)
} else {
log.Printf("User %s not found", email)
}
}
system.Users = userIDs
}
}
// Get existing systems
existingSystems, err := h.app.Dao().FindRecordsByExpr("systems", dbx.NewExp("id != ''"))
if err != nil {
return err
}
// Create a map of existing systems for easy lookup
existingSystemsMap := make(map[string]*models.Record)
for _, system := range existingSystems {
key := system.GetString("host") + ":" + system.GetString("port")
existingSystemsMap[key] = system
}
// Process systems from config
for _, sysConfig := range config.Systems {
key := sysConfig.Host + ":" + strconv.Itoa(int(sysConfig.Port))
if existingSystem, ok := existingSystemsMap[key]; ok {
// Update existing system
existingSystem.Set("name", sysConfig.Name)
existingSystem.Set("users", sysConfig.Users)
existingSystem.Set("port", sysConfig.Port)
if err := h.app.Dao().SaveRecord(existingSystem); err != nil {
return err
}
delete(existingSystemsMap, key)
} else {
// Create new system
systemsCollection, err := h.app.Dao().FindCollectionByNameOrId("systems")
if err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("failed to find systems collection: %v", err)
}
newSystem := models.NewRecord(systemsCollection)
newSystem.Set("name", sysConfig.Name)
newSystem.Set("host", sysConfig.Host)
newSystem.Set("port", sysConfig.Port)
newSystem.Set("users", sysConfig.Users)
newSystem.Set("info", system.Info{})
newSystem.Set("status", "pending")
if err := h.app.Dao().SaveRecord(newSystem);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("failed to create new system: %v", err)
}
}
}
// Delete systems not in config
for _, system := range existingSystemsMap {
if err := h.app.Dao().DeleteRecord(system); err != nil {
return err
}
}
log.Println("Systems synced with config.yml")
return nil
}
// Generates content for the config.yml file as a YAML string
func (h *Hub) generateConfigYAML() (string, error) {
// Fetch all systems from the database
systems, err := h.app.Dao().FindRecordsByFilter("systems", "id != ''", "name", -1, 0)
if err != nil {
return "", err
}
// Create a Config struct to hold the data
config := Config{
Systems: make([]SystemConfig, 0, len(systems)),
}
// Fetch all users at once
allUserIDs := make([]string, 0)
for _, system := range systems {
allUserIDs = append(allUserIDs, system.GetStringSlice("users")...)
}
userEmailMap, err := h.getUserEmailMap(allUserIDs)
if err != nil {
return "", err
}
// Populate the Config struct with system data
for _, system := range systems {
userIDs := system.GetStringSlice("users")
userEmails := make([]string, 0, len(userIDs))
for _, userID := range userIDs {
if email, ok := userEmailMap[userID]; ok {
userEmails = append(userEmails, email)
}
}
sysConfig := SystemConfig{
Name: system.GetString("name"),
Host: system.GetString("host"),
Port: cast.ToUint16(system.Get("port")),
Users: userEmails,
}
config.Systems = append(config.Systems, sysConfig)
}
// Marshal the Config struct to YAML
yamlData, err := yaml.Marshal(&config)
if err != nil {
return "", err
}
// Add a header to the YAML
yamlData = append([]byte("# Values for port and users are optional.\n# Defaults are port 45876 and the first created user.\n\n"), yamlData...)
return string(yamlData), nil
}
// New helper function to get a map of user IDs to emails
func (h *Hub) getUserEmailMap(userIDs []string) (map[string]string, error) {
users, err := h.app.Dao().FindRecordsByIds("users", userIDs)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
userEmailMap := make(map[string]string, len(users))
for _, user := range users {
userEmailMap[user.Id] = user.GetString("email")
}
return userEmailMap, nil
}
// Returns the current config.yml file as a JSON object
func (h *Hub) getYamlConfig(c echo.Context) error {
requestData := apis.RequestInfo(c)
if requestData.AuthRecord == nil || requestData.AuthRecord.GetString("role") != "admin" {
return apis.NewForbiddenError("Forbidden", nil)
}
configContent, err := h.generateConfigYAML()
if err != nil {
return err
}
return c.JSON(200, map[string]string{"config": configContent})
}
